The postcode LS5 3LL is located in Leeds, in the county of West Yorksh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. LS5 3LL is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

LS5 3LL is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of LS5 3LL as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> Multi-ethnic professionals with families.

The closest road name to LS5 3LL is Cragside Place which is centered 59 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Broadway and is 321 m away. The closest railway station is Headingley Rail Station, 2.06 km away.

The closest primary school to LS5 3LL (for ages 11 and under) is Hawksworth Wood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on March 4, 2020.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Abbey Grange Church of England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on February 22, 2017 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of LS5 3LL is The Bridge and is 699 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on July 6,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Jade Unicorn and is 827 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on January 14, 2019.

Residents reported an average download speed of 101.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 15.2 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.6 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for LS5 3LL is covered by the West Yorkshire police force association and Leeds is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
